MEETING THE GOVERNOR.
INNOVATION AT HOBART. An innovation by the Tasmanian Labour Government in the form of a reception at the City Hall to enable tho general publjc to meet the newly-appointed Governor, Sir James O'Grady, and his family proved a great success. No invitations were issued; 1700 people attended and were introduced to the Governor.
